“Fred the Fork” was conceived in response to a request for new musical material for John D Elliott’s group “Brasso ProFUNdo” or “Low Brass”! It is scored in this version for two tenor tubas and a bass tuba, but can also be played by horn and trombone plus tuba. The title alludes to a song written in 1928 Berlin by Weill and Brecht which has metamorphosised into a jazz standard. Like the original, “Fred the Fork” is in “swing” style and incorporates upward transpositions after each verse. Listen out for the cryptic musical quotation at the end.
